Output 3c59bc9a3da05c849ef7125d809bc0bea3de2f5c962b351271047d1988980f61:1

value
101063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f24ab5acf2d8f7504d8e20b9b3c3222d0be96dd0 OP_EQUAL
address
3Pn8wtKS5TMX5HG38J5XDV3wKzCaEo6oey
transaction
3c59bc9a3da05c849ef7125d809bc0bea3de2f5c962b351271047d1988980f61
confirmations
277967
spent
true